Introduction
Singcat.com, a web hosting provider based in Indonesia, has been in operation since 2007. Despite its long-standing presence in the industry, the company has garnered a poor reputation, with an average user rating of 1.4 out of 10 based on 5 reviews. Singcat offered services such as shared hosting, domain registration, and email hosting, targeting primarily the Indonesian market. However, the company is currently inactive, and its services are no longer recommended by users due to numerous complaints about poor support, frequent downtime, and unresolved technical issues.

Features
Singcat.com provided a range of hosting services, including shared hosting plans with unlimited bandwidth and disk space starting from 100MB. Their plans were priced between IDR 100,000 and IDR 1,700,000, catering to small to medium-sized businesses. The company also offered domain registration services for popular extensions like .com, .net, and .id, with prices ranging from IDR 147,257 to IDR 330,000 per year.
Despite these offerings, users reported significant issues with Singcat’s services. Complaints included frequent server downtime, lack of customer support, and failure to resolve technical problems. The company claimed to offer 24/7 support, but reviews indicate that this was not the case, with many users unable to reach support via email, phone, or tickets.
Singcat’s hosting plans were marketed as affordable, but the poor service quality and lack of reliability made them a less viable option for businesses.
